Job Description Passaic County Community College is seeking a Program and Career Coordinator for our WIOA Out-of-School Youth Program. This person will work closely with program participants to ensure their success in the WIOA Out-of-School Youth Program and will coordinate outreach, activities, and services with employers, program staff, instructors, and students. The Program and Career Coordinator is responsible for developing and coordinating a wide array of career development programs to set students on a successful career pathway. This is a full-time, grant funded administrative position. Example of Duties: • Coordinate program outreach, activities, and services with employers, program staff, instructors, and students., • Enter student data and maintain student database; maintain student files., • Assist in marketing the program and recruiting eligible program participants., • Conduct intake and orientation to enroll students into appropriate programs or refer to other programs or services., • Provide personal, academic, and career counseling to program participants; coordinate supplementary support services for program participants, and refer students for academic and support services, as needed., • Build strong relationships with other agencies and organizations for referral purposes., • Develop, provide, and facilitate workshops geared toward student and career success., • Monitor participant attendance and progress throughout their time in the program and address issues, as they arise., • Review, sign, and submit student timesheets for government benefit programs., • Provide job search support and guidance activities, including resume review and development, interview coaching, and job counseling and other activities that will lead to successful job placements and career development, and assist students with job placement or further studies., • Participate in all aspects of program evaluation., • Bachelor's degree in Educaton, Counseling, Psychology, Student Personnel Services, or related field required., • Minimum one year experience in student counseling, student services, and/or academic advisement required., • Prior experience working effectively with diverse, low-income youth/adult student populations preferred., • Outstanding interpersonal and communication skills, both written and verbal, required, • Excellent computer and database management skills required, • Previous experience working on a grant-funded project a plus Compensation: Salary is determined by a variety of criteria, including but not limited to, previous relevant experience, education level, and certifications. The starting salary for this position is $45,000.
